Consider the following nonfunctional requirements and determine which of them can be verified and which cannot. Write acceptance tests for each requirement or explain why it is not testable.
(a) "The user interface must be user-friendly and easy to use."
(b) "The number of mouse clicks the user needs to perform when navigating to any window of the system’s user interface must be less than 10."
(c) "The user interface of the new system must be simple enough so that any user can use it with a minimum training."
(d) "The maximum latency from the moment the user clicks a hyperlink in a web page until the rendering of the new web page starts is 1 second over a broadband connection."
(e) "In case of failure, the system must be easy to recover and must suffer minimum loss of important data."
